No Korean New Year's celebration is complete without tteokguk, or rice cake soup. In fact, Koreans consider themselves a year older when eating a bowl of tteokguk. The traditional dish also represents a wish for a prosperous New Year. For this New Year's special, the chef and her cooking class students join us to make this hearty soup to share with neighbors.
